Understanding the Carnivora Diet

Dogs follow a carnivora diet because they come from wolves. This diet is key for their health. It includes animal protein, healthy fats, and vitamins. These are vital for their well-being.

Why Carnivores Need Specific Nutritional Support

Dogs are different from omnivores in their diet needs. Their bodies are made for meat, with a lot of protein and fat. They need high-quality animal proteins for important amino acids.

They also need linoleic acid and omega-3 fatty acids for skin and coat health. Dogs don’t need much carbohydrates. They can make their own glucose or get it from a little bit of carbs.

The Role of Natural Supplements in a Carnivore Diet

Natural supplements like Carnivora are important for dogs. They fill in the gaps left by processed foods. These supplements add probiotics and omega fatty acids to the diet.

This makes sure dogs get what they need for good health. It helps them live well and meet their carnivore diet needs.

NutrientSourceImportance
ProteinAnimal goods like lamb, beef, chickenBuilds muscle and supports metabolic functions
FatOils and fatty fishProvides energy and supports skin health
VitaminsFruits/vegetables (as supplements)Essential for various bodily functions
MineralsSupplementation as neededSupports bone health and metabolic processes
FiberPrey componentsSupports healthy digestion

Signs of Nutritional Deficiencies in Dogs

Nutritional deficiencies in dogs can cause health problems. These problems often show up as physical signs. It’s important for pet owners to know these signs to keep their dogs healthy. By understanding how certain deficiencies show up, pet parents can choose the right diet for their dogs. Supplements like Carnivora can also help.

Common Health Issues Related to Deficiencies

Many health issues come from not getting enough nutrients. Spotting these problems early can stop them from getting worse. Here are some common signs linked to specific deficiencies:

  • Skin Irritations: Not having enough fatty acids can cause skin problems. It’s important to watch what your dog eats for these nutrients.
  • Muscle Weakness: Not getting enough protein can make muscles weak. This shows how important protein is in a dog’s diet.
  • Stunted Growth: Puppies may grow slowly if they don’t get all the vitamins and minerals they need.
  • Dental Problems: Not getting enough nutrients can hurt oral health, leading to gum disease.
  • Weakened Immune System: Dogs without the right nutrients can’t fight infections and diseases as well.

There’s a strong link between not getting enough nutrients and health problems in dogs. A balanced diet is key to keeping your dog healthy. Regular vet check-ups can spot these issues early. Then, you can make changes to your dog’s diet and use supplements like Carnivora to help.

DeficiencyCommon SymptomsPotential Health Risks
Fatty AcidsDry skin, coat loss, flakingIncreased risk of infections
ProteinMuscle wasting, weaknessImpaired growth, lethargy
Vitamin APoor eyesight, night blindnessWeakened immune response
CalciumWeak bones, dental problemsIncreased risk of fractures
Vitamins B12 & DFatigue, poor appetiteBone health issues, neurological problems
